THURSDAY, JANUARY 17 (6:30 - 8:30 pm) Workshop presented by the Center for Racial Justice in Education, hosted by PS 39's Diversity & Inclusion Committee and sponsored by the Parent Association. This two-hour workshop will provide participants with: a deeper knowledge of the history and definition of race and racism, an enhanced understanding of how race and racism affect children and how children see race, skills for approaching age-appropriate conversations using a racial equity lens.
